TPO – On the night of September 9, floodwaters on the Chay River continued to rise, causing many streets and houses in Bao Yen district ( Lao Cai ) to be submerged in water.

According to reporters, on the night of September 9, in Bao Yen district, Lao Cai province, it rained heavily and flood water rose rapidly.

Faced with the critical flood situation, officers and soldiers of the Bao Yen District Military Command and local rescue forces mobilized vehicles to urgently search for people trapped in houses and bring them to safety that same night.

Electricity on the roads in Pho Rang town has been cut off, making it difficult for forces to move and search and rescue.

According to announcements from hydropower plants upstream of the Chay River, on the night of September 9, the discharge to the downstream decreased compared to the afternoon, however, the amount is still very large so the flood on the Chay River is expected to recede slowly.

Faced with that situation, the District People's Committee directed the People's Committees of communes and towns to mobilize local forces and people in the area to help affected families; proactively arrange and provide necessary necessities to flooded and completely isolated households; and propagate so that people absolutely do not neglect or be subjective.

As of 10:30 a.m. on September 10, the total number of houses in Bao Yen district affected and damaged was 518, supporting the evacuation of 166 households in 13 communes due to flooding and the risk of landslides to a safe place. Estimated damage was 4 billion VND.

The total affected agricultural, forestry and fishery production area and damage was 556.1 hectares, with estimated damage of over 6 billion VND; about 21 traffic infrastructure works were damaged, with estimated damage of over 1.5 billion VND.

Mr. Tran Trong Thong - Chairman of Bao Yen District People's Committee directed communes and towns to continue to deploy, inspect, review, and at the same time propagate and guide people on how to prevent, avoid, and respond to all types of natural disasters, minimizing possible damage.
